Some fixes

main
Antonio De Lucreziis 2 years ago
parent 142c5e1b67
commit d623df9158

@ -2,6 +2,24 @@ import { Icon } from './Icon.jsx'
export const Help = ({}) => ( export const Help = ({}) => (
<> <>
<h3>Mobile</h3>
<p>
Da mobile ci sono tre visualizzazioni possibili
<ul>
<li>
<Icon name="list" /> <b>Corsi</b> mostra una lista dei corsi in ordine
alfabetico con ogni lezione per corso
</li>
<li>
<Icon name="calendar_view_month" /> <b>Schema</b> mostra uno schema compatto dei
corsi selezionati
</li>
<li>
<Icon name="calendar_view_day" />
<b>Giorno</b> invece una visualizzazione giornaliera della settimana
</li>
</ul>
</p>
<h3>Selezione Corsi</h3> <h3>Selezione Corsi</h3>
<p> <p>
Per visualizzare solo una selezione dei corsi disponibili, clicca su quelli che ti Per visualizzare solo una selezione dei corsi disponibili, clicca su quelli che ti
@ -22,13 +40,6 @@ export const Help = ({}) => (
Alternativamente, puoi scegliere fra tutti i corsi disponibili cliccando su <b>Tutti</b>{' '} Alternativamente, puoi scegliere fra tutti i corsi disponibili cliccando su <b>Tutti</b>{' '}
(equivalente al tasto su <Icon name="apps" /> mobile). (equivalente al tasto su <Icon name="apps" /> mobile).
</p> </p>
<p>
Da mobile ci sono tre visualizzazioni possibili dei corsi, la modalità <b>Corsi</b>{' '}
<Icon name="list" /> mostra una lista dei corsi in ordine alfabetico con ogni lezione
per corso; <b>Schema</b> <Icon name="calendar_view_month" /> mostra uno schema compatto
dei corsi selezionati. <b>Giorno</b> invece una visualizzazione giornaliera della
settimana.
</p>
<h3>Stampa</h3> <h3>Stampa</h3>
<p> <p>
Da desktop puoi stampare l'orario attualmente visibile con il bottone{' '} Da desktop puoi stampare l'orario attualmente visibile con il bottone{' '}

@ -2,7 +2,7 @@ import { CompoundButton } from './CompoundButton.jsx'
import { MODE_COURSE, MODE_SCHEDULE, MODE_WORKWEEK_GRID } from './EventsView.jsx' import { MODE_COURSE, MODE_SCHEDULE, MODE_WORKWEEK_GRID } from './EventsView.jsx'
import { Icon } from './Icon.jsx' import { Icon } from './Icon.jsx'
export const OptionBar = ({ mode, setMode, source, setSource, onHelp }) => { export const OptionBar = ({ mode, setMode, source, setSource }) => {
return ( return (
<div class="option-bar"> <div class="option-bar">
<div class="option-group"> <div class="option-group">

@ -3,13 +3,13 @@ import { render } from 'preact'
import { useEffect, useState } from 'preact/hooks' import { useEffect, useState } from 'preact/hooks'
import { ToolOverlay } from './components/CourseVisibility.jsx' import { ToolOverlay } from './components/CourseVisibility.jsx'
import { EventsView, MODE_COURSE, MODE_WORKWEEK_GRID } from './components/EventsView.jsx' import { EventsView, MODE_COURSE } from './components/EventsView.jsx'
import { HamburgerMenu } from './components/HamburgerMenu.jsx' import { HamburgerMenu } from './components/HamburgerMenu.jsx'
import { Help } from './components/Help.jsx' import { Help } from './components/Help.jsx'
import { Icon } from './components/Icon.jsx' import { Icon } from './components/Icon.jsx'
import { Popup } from './components/Popup.jsx' import { Popup } from './components/Popup.jsx'
import { Toolbar } from './components/Toolbar.jsx' import { Toolbar } from './components/Toolbar.jsx'
import { OptionBar } from './components/Optionbar.jsx' import { OptionBar } from './components/OptionBar.jsx'
window._ = _ window._ = _
window.dataBuffer = {} window.dataBuffer = {}

@ -412,6 +412,13 @@ button,
vertical-align: text-top; vertical-align: text-top;
} }
} }
ul {
padding: 0.5rem 0 0.5rem 1.5rem;
display: flex;
flex-direction: column;
gap: 0.5rem;
}
} }
// Structure // Structure

Loading…
Cancel
Save